The Role

We are seeking an experienced and highly motivated Senior FPGA Engineer to design and implement the control and interface functions of our OTPU system. This role spans production system delivery and advanced hardware prototyping. You will work on high‑bandwidth architectures involving high‑speed interfaces, precision timing, transceivers, and signal‑processing pipelines. The position requires close collaboration across FPGA, ASIC, hardware, optical, and software teams.

Responsibilities

  • Design and implement FPGA subsystems and hardware modules for high‑performance systems.
  • Develop and optimise high‑speed interface subsystems (PCIe Gen4, multi‑lane transceivers operating at >25 Gb/s NRZ).
  • Implement and validate link integrity features including BER measurement and error correction (ECC, including SECDED).
  • Develop and integrate memory interfaces as required by system architecture.
  • Contribute to hardware prototyping activities in support of silicon development.
  • Collaborate with software engineers to enable low‑level driver development and hardware control.
  • Work with hardware and optical engineers to ensure robust system integration and synchronisation.
  • Implement timing‑critical and real‑time control logic.
  • Conduct testing, validation, and performance optimisation under demanding operating conditions.
  • Debug complex hardware–software interactions and resolve system‑level issues.

Skills & Experience

  • 5+ years of FPGA design experience, including 3+ years working with high‑speed interfaces and signal‑processing pipelines.
  • Strong experience with PCIe and high‑speed transceivers.
  • Solid understanding of precision timing and synchronisation in complex systems.
  • Experience with deterministic networking and time‑distribution systems (such as White Rabbit).
  • Experience integrating external memory subsystems.
  • Verification experience using COCOTB, UVVM, or OSVVM.
  • Proficiency in Verilog and/or VHDL.
  • Python and scripting experience.
  • Experience with Xilinx/AMD UltraScale+ or Versal devices.
  • Strong debugging skills across hardware–software boundaries.
  •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or a related field.

Due to U.S. export control regulations, candidates’ eligibility to work at OLIX depends on their most recent citizenship or permanent residency status. We are generally unable to consider applicants whose most recent citizenship or permanent residence is in certain restricted countries (currently including Iran, North Korea, Syria, Cuba, Russia, Belarus, China, Hong Kong, Macau, and Venezuela). Applicants who have subsequently obtained citizenship or permanent residency in another country not subject to these restrictions may still be eligible.
